Not Shadowrun based, but could certainly spice up a Seattle based adventure.
http://www.kickstarter.com/projects/tonydo...le-doomsday-map QUOTE There’s no other map quite like this in the world. I’ve rendered every building in downtown Seattle and Capitol Hill in meticulous detail. Habitable areas, structures, and hazards to navigation are clearly marked. I’m also printing a guidebook, “Dee Dee’s Doomsday Guide to Surviving in Post-Apocalyptic Seattle” that provides valuable information for the visitor, such as the location of the radiation leak in Sodo, who sells fresh produce in Belltown, and what’s the worst threat to your safety in Cal Anderson Park, not to mention the locations of zombie infestations, landmines, biological hazards, underground distilleries, and roving motorcycle gangs. $5 for a PDF version isn't bad, $20 for a standard map fold is quite a deal. |
